Texas Education Agency (TEA)

The Business Analyst (BA) position at the Texas Education Agency works on multiple projects that support the mission of the agency of improving outcomes for Texas students, with a focus on major enhancements and/or rewrite effort.

This position will perform advanced, senior-level business analysis work. The business analyst serves as the conduit between the program/customer community and the software development team through which requirements flow. This BA will be involved at some level throughout the entire software development life cycle. Upon establishment of the requirements baseline, the focus is shifted towards the management of the requirements specification and verifying the fulfillment of all requirements, including requirements for enhancements post-implementation.

Essential Functions:
1 - Elicitation & Analysis - Analyzes user needs, business processes, pain points, and computer system capabilities to automate or improve existing systems. Elicits requirements using joint application development (JAD), interviews, document analysis, surveys, use cases, competitive product analysis, and workflow analysis.
2 - Requirements Writing & Visual Output
Transforms information from elicitation sessions into business and functional requirements, use cases, user stories, software requirements specifications documents, wireframes, and mockups. Uses standard templates and simple, unambiguous, and concise natural language.
3 - BA Best Practices & Mentorship
Acts as a mentor to peers and colleagues in disseminating best practices and proactively seeks out training opportunities.
4 - Using TEA Tools Effectively
Uses TEA tools, such as Jira and Modern Requirements, to manage the change control process, participate in the SDLC, and track and communicate requirements status.
